Farizon SV L1 Electric H1

Range of up to 234 miles
Electric Vans

A practical fit for urban delivery fleets, local couriers and service businesses that need a compact van for city streets, the Farizon SV has a load capacity of 1265kg and a battery range of up to 234 miles.

Farizon SV L3 Electric H3

Range of up to 247 miles
Electric Vans

The larger variant of the Farizon SV sacrifices a little payload capacity for much greater volume. This is an excellent option for utilities fleets and larger couriers, with its load capacity of 1075kg and a battery range of up to 247 miles.

Understanding Range and Charging for Farizon Electric Vans

Farizon quotes a WLTP range of up to 247 miles combined, with higher figures possible in lower speed city driving depending on model and battery choice. For most businesses, the more useful measure is how the van performs in day-to-day operations. Electric vans are great for predictable daily routes, especially when they can be charged overnight at a depot or workplace. Here are some of the operational factors that may affect electric van range when Farizon electric van leasing:

  • Payload and cargo weight – Heavier loads increase energy use, so vans carrying full payloads will usually cover fewer miles than lightly loaded vehicles.
  • Route types – Urban routes can suit electric vans well as lower speeds and frequent braking can help efficiency. Longer motorway driving usually uses more battery. A combination of these routes will result in a mixture of these results.
  • Weather conditions – Cold temperatures can reduce battery performance and increase the use of heating. Hot weather may increase demand from cabin cooling.
  • Driving behaviour and stop-start use – Smooth acceleration and steady driving help maximise range. Heavy acceleration and high-speed driving will tend to reduce it.
  • Charging availability – Businesses with reliable charging at the depot or workplace are often best placed to get the most from electric vans, as vehicles can be topped up between shifts or left to charge overnight.
